Running a profitable personal lines book of business is harder than ever for insurance brokerages. Market conditions, rising costs, talent shortages, and staffing constraints are just some of the challenges that hinder profit margins, scalability, and exceptional client service. Trusted by 5 of Canada’s top 10 brokerages, Quandri is transforming the renewal process with AI-driven automation, enabling proactive workflows and delivering data-driven insights.
Today’s renewal process is often reactive, with brokers focusing on clients who request help rather than adopting a proactive, data-driven approach. Quandri is revolutionizing renewals by offering a platform that uses AI and automation to streamline operations. This allows brokerages to retain more business, enhance client and staff experiences, reduce E&O risk, and boost sales through upselling and cross-selling.

About the Role:
As a Recruiter at Quandri, you’ll drive our growth by owning the full recruitment cycle, from strategy to execution. You'll partner with leadership and hiring managers to develop tailored hiring plans and source and hire exceptional talent. Leveraging your experience with high-growth environments, you'll optimize our recruitment process to improve key metrics such as time-to-hire, offer acceptance rates, and few mis-hires. Your ability to analyze recruitment data and provide strategic insights will be key to scaling our hiring efforts. If you thrive in a fast-paced, high-impact role, where you'll build relationships, drive innovation, and act like an owner, this is your opportunity to help shape the future of a rapidly growing company.
- Develop and execute hiring strategies that align with the organization’s goals.
- Expertly manage stakeholder relationships and ensure effective communication channels between leadership, hiring managers, other interviewers and the candidate.
- Own and run full-cycle recruiting end to end for all open positions.
- Source exceptional candidates for all but especially hard to fill roles.
- Improve and scale our current recruitment process to lead to improved measurable results such as time to hire, offer acceptance rate and few mishires.
- Help prioritize and manage current and forecasted recruitment planning for the entire organization.
- Research, recommend then attend industry events and job fairs and sessions representing Quandri
- Analyze recruitment data (e.g., time-to-fill, offer acceptance rates) and provide insights to improve hiring strategies.
